Job description

Description

The Maintenance Technician is responsible for performing a variety of maintenance and repair tasks to ensure the safety, functionality, and appearance of facilities. This role requires a working knowledge of electrical, plumbing, carpentry, and general maintenance practices. The technician must be able to travel to various work locations on demand.

Key Responsibilities
  • Inspect buildings and structures to identify functional systems, malfunctions, and needed repairs.
  • Perform minor electrical maintenance, including replacement or repair of fixtures, switches, outlets, bulbs, ballasts, and cords.
  • Conduct minor plumbing repairs such as fixing leaks, unclogging drains, and replacing hoses.
  • Carry out minor painting, carpentry, and masonry work including surface preparation, painting, and hardware installation.
  • Perform general cleaning and upkeep of facilities.
  • Operate and maintain mechanical tools, paint equipment, and floor machines.
  • Perform other tasks as assigned.
Requirements

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ities Required:

  • High school diploma or GED with a certificate in trade school or equivalent work experience related to facilities and/or maintenance.
  • Basic understanding of facility-related systems and operations.
  • Valid driver's license with a good driving record and insurable by agency insurance.
  • Ability to prioritize and manage multiple tasks.
Working Conditions
  • Frequent standing, walking, hand dexterity, reaching with hands and arms, climbing or balancing, stooping, kneeling, crouching, crawling, speaking, and listening.
  • Occasional sitting.
  • Frequently lift and/or move more than 100 pounds.
  • Specific vision abilities required include close vision, distance vision, color vision, and depth perception.
